Elaine Trindade: Bridging Lusophony and the Digital Canvas Portuguese artist Elaine Trindade is a compelling figure at the intersection of traditional artistic practices and cutting-edge digital media. Her work, deeply rooted in her Lusophone heritage – specifically Portugal and Brazil – explores themes of memory, identity, and the evolving nature of cultural representation within the contemporary landscape.
